The Importance of the 98% RTP
One of the most noteworthy aspects of Chicken Road is its exceptional Return to Player (RTP) rate of 98%. In the world of online games, the RTP represents the percentage of wagered money that is theoretically returned to players over time. A higher RTP indicates a more favorable game for players, as it suggests a reduced house edge. A 98% RTP means that, on average, players receive $98 back for every $100 wagered.
Compared to many other online games, where RTP rates often hover around 95% or lower, the Chicken Road RTP is significantly more generous. This higher RTP enhances the long-term appeal of the game, providing players with a greater chance of achieving consistent wins.
